is it hard to Swim 500 yards in 12min for a average swimmer?

i am applying for a job:}
these are the requirements:
Lifeguard- 500 yards any stroke in 12 minutes or less, no stopping to rest (goggles ok. No fins, or kick boards). Tread water for 2 minutes without the use of your hands. Retrieve a 10 lb brick from the 9ft area. Not necessarily in that order. If [...]
